Output 581d3ce2eb58e8fdb894af4349076c8317444b5eac03f61ace1ef16e3efefefd:2

value
212057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0589cbccd26afef6317dfb16b0a2e0b3a13fa342 OP_EQUAL
address
32CJNk4xBtxMkbmECVBtEnE9osoFjtwnDL
transaction
581d3ce2eb58e8fdb894af4349076c8317444b5eac03f61ace1ef16e3efefefd
spent
true